Buckmore Park Karting for Kids Review - Our boy went to Bambino sessions when he was younger and wasn’t so confident, he didn’t enjoy it as much as he does now. He is 10 now and that has clearly made a huge difference to him. He is much more confident in going for it and much more aware of the others on the track, so much, much safer too!
